Omniscient: A Dark MC Romance: Book 2 of The Filthy Kings Trilogy

Rate this book
THE SAINT WHO COMMANDS HELL..

"And through bloodied vision and the unbearable metallic stench, I witness Blaze in his most authentic form; both shockingly beautiful and horrifically grotesque. He’s half heaven and half hell…"

A Dark and Erotic MC Romance

Anti-rule breaker and psychologist, Grace Suwan, finds herself in the clutches of a ruthless biker gang, reluctantly accepting the “deal of a lifetime.” Protection in exchange for a no-questions-asked IOU. But when the bloodthirsty, ill-tempered and yet, smokin’ hot, president of The Crimson Jackals, Blaze Shinoda, AKA ‘The Ogre’ pursues her, and Gracie surrenders to her desires, she knows that she’s risking more than just her life, but also her heart.

As their passions reach erotic heights and new threats emerge, can they trust each other enough to beat the odds and unearth who’s trying to kill Gracie — before time runs out? Or will the horrors of what’s to come incinerate their chance at true love?

492 pages, Paperback

First published January 23, 2024

As someone who loves a good MC (motorcycle club) romance, I went into Omniscient with high hopes—especially after the setup from the first book in the Filthy Kings trilogy. And while this installment definitely delivers on the spice, I found myself wishing for a bit more balance between the smut and the story.

The plot had a lot of potential. Grace, the FMC, goes through some intense and dramatic moments—being shot in the head and ending up in a coma, for example, but the pacing of these events and the way they’re followed up left me scratching my head. The day after waking from a coma, Grace is immediately back in the sheets, and that kind of unrealistic storytelling really pulled me out of the moment.

I don’t mind a steamy read—in fact, I usually love it but in Omniscient, it felt like nearly every chapter revolved around sex, to the point where it overshadowed the actual narrative. It seemed like smex was the go-to solution for every conflict or emotional moment, and by the end, I found myself skipping chapters just to get back to the meat of the story.

All that said, I did enjoy parts of the book, and I think with a bit more depth and pacing, it could’ve been great. Here’s hoping the final book in the trilogy finds a better balance between the heat and the heart.
